Supporting SUD Providers in the Transition to ASAM Criteria, 4th Edition Standards
Colorado is preparing to transition to the American Society of Addiction Medicine (ASAM) Criteria 4th Edition Standards, effective July 1, 2026. The Department of Health Care Policy and Financing and Behavioral Health Administration continue to hold monthly listening sessions with substance use disorder (SUD) providers to gather feedback and address questions and concerns regarding the transition. More information is posted on the BHA website, including the registration link for upcoming sessions.
HCPF and BHA plan to support SUD providers through a Provider Ambassador Program for SUD providers who currently deliver ASAM 3.2WM services. They have contracted with Health Management Associates, Inc. (HMA) to provide direct technical assistance and resources to assist 3.2WM providers in preparing for the ASAM 4 transition. HCPF will share more information about the program and how to participate at its upcoming benefit provider forum on April 2. More information is on HCPF’s website.
